Questions and Answers

What is the cheapest way to get from Penge to Erith?

The cheapest way to get from Penge to Erith is to drive which costs $4.46 - $7.07 and takes 27 min.

What is the fastest way to get from Penge to Erith?

The fastest way to get from Penge to Erith is to taxi which takes 27 min and costs $40.22 - $47.83 .

Is there a direct bus between Penge and Erith?

No, there is no direct bus from Penge to Erith. However, there are services departing from Penge / Sainsbury's and arriving at Fraser Road via Bromley North Station and Sidcup Station / Station Road.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 30m.

Is there a direct train between Penge and Erith?

No, there is no direct train from Penge to Erith. However, there are services departing from Clock House and arriving at Erith via Lewisham.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 52 min.

How far is it from Penge to Erith?

The distance between Penge and Erith is 24 km. The road distance is 22.6 km.
